Why Planets Beat the Pollution
The biggest hurdle for any city-based astronomer is light pollution. The constant glow from streetlights, buildings, and advertisements creates a bright haze that washes out faint, distant stars. But planets are a different story. Unlike stars, which
are distant suns producing their own light, planets are much closer and shine by reflecting the light of our Sun. Jupiter and Saturn are large and relatively close, making them intensely bright points of light in our sky. Their brightness is often enough to punch through the urban glow, making them prime targets for city stargazers. While faint nebulae and distant galaxies are lost to the city lights, these two gas giants remain surprisingly accessible.
Know When and Where to Look
Timing is everything. For September 2026, both planets are well-positioned for viewing. Saturn rises in the evening, around 9:30 PM early in the month, appearing as a bright, steady 'star' in the southeastern sky. It will be visible for most of the night. Jupiter makes its appearance in the early morning. At the beginning of September, it rises a few hours before the sun, but by the end of the month, it will be high enough for great viewing in the dark, predawn hours. A great opportunity arises on the morning of September 8th, when a crescent moon will be seen near Jupiter, making the gas giant easy to locate. On September 26th, the full Harvest Moon will be near Saturn, providing another easy signpost. Planets travel along a path in the sky called the ecliptic, the same general path the sun and moon follow.
Your Smartphone is a Planetarium
You don't need to be an expert to find your way around the night sky. There is a fantastic array of smartphone apps that turn your phone into an augmented reality guide. Apps like SkyView, Star Walk 2, and Star Chart allow you to simply point your phone at the sky to identify planets, stars, and constellations in real-time. For those interested in a more India-centric view, the Bhagol app maps the sky using traditional Indian astronomical concepts, including the nakshatras and grahas. Many of these apps are free and incredibly user-friendly, instantly telling you if that bright light you're looking at is Jupiter, a satellite, or an airplane.
Simple Gear for a Better View
While you can spot Jupiter and Saturn with just your naked eye, a simple pair of binoculars will transform your experience. You won't need an expensive telescope to get started. A standard pair of 7x50 or 10x50 binoculars is powerful enough to reveal Jupiter as a distinct disk, and you might even glimpse its four largest moons, the Galilean moons, appearing as tiny pinpricks of light flanking the planet. Through binoculars, Saturn will lose its star-like appearance and look slightly elongated or oval-shaped, a clear hint of its famous rings. For the best results, try to steady your binoculars. Resting them on a wall or, even better, using a simple tripod will eliminate the shakiness from your hands and provide a much clearer image.
Tricks to Beat the Urban Glow
To maximise your chances, a little preparation goes a long way. Find the darkest spot available to you, whether it's a rooftop, a balcony shielded from streetlights, or a nearby park. Once you're there, give your eyes at least 15-20 minutes to adapt to the darkness; this will dramatically increase your ability to see fainter objects. Avoid looking at your bright phone screen during this time. Another simple but effective trick is to create a personal light shield by cupping your hands around your eyes or using a piece of cardboard to block out stray light from your peripheral vision. This small action can significantly improve the contrast of what you see in the eyepiece or through your binoculars.
